Economic aid, also known as financial assistance, refers to the help given to countries or individuals to improve their economic conditions. Some noteworthy synonyms for economic aid include economic grants, financial donations, monetary support, and development assistance. These terms are commonly used to describe different types of aid offered to nations with a view to enhancing their economic well-being. Economic grants are direct payments to support a nation's economy, while financial donations are given to organizations or individuals to support economic development. Monetary support is often given in the form of loans, while development assistance is a broader term which encompasses different types of aid aimed at promoting economic growth. Overall, economic aid is a crucial factor in helping countries and individuals overcome economic challenges and achieve greater prosperity.
